WebFeb 2, 2024 · Yet these middle housing types—so familiar to our grandparents and great-grandparents—are rarely built today. Dan Parolek of Opticos Design coined the term “missing middle housing” to describe middle housing options that are in high-demand (across all age groups) but getting harder and harder to find. WebJun 1, 2024 · Missing middle housing types such as duplexes, fourplexes, five- to 10-unit mansion apartments, cottage courts, and courtyard apartments were once — and can be again — an important part of the solution to the housing shortage and could be in every city’s toolbox.
